Lexical Definition

‎תָּפַף‎ tâphaph (taw-faf') to beat H:V
a primitive root

taber, play with timbrels.

1) to play or sound the timbrel, beat, play upon, drum (on a timbrel or other object)
1a) (Qal) playing (participle)
1b) (Poel) beating (participle)

See Greek: φθέγγομαι

Usage: 2 forms in 2 verses
Form Translated As     In Verse(s)
תּוֹפֵפֽוֹת playing tambourines Ps.68.25
מְתֹפְפֹ֖ת beating Nah.2.7

Brown-Driver-Briggs

[‎תָּפַף‎] verb denominative sound the timbrel, beat; —

Qal Participle ‎עֲלָמוֺת תֹּפֵפוֺת‎ Ps 68:26* read Imperfect ‎וַיָּ֫תָף‎ 1Sam 21:14* ᵐ5 (see ‎תוה‎). Po`el Participle ‎מְתֹפְפֹת עַללִֿבֵהֶן כְּקוֺל יוֺנִים‎ Nah 2:8* > Sta (after ᵐ5) ‎מְצַפְצְפוֺת‎ twittering.
